#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""SeqAn code generation from templates / skeletons.

This module contains code to help the creation of modules, tests, apps etc.
It can be called directly or imported and the main() function can be called.

It will perform the following replacements:

  %(AUTHOR)s  will be replaced by the author's name, either given on command
              line or taken from environment variable SEQAN_AUTHOR.

  %(NAME)s    will be replaced by the name of the generated code.
  %(TITLE)s   will be replaced by the name of the generated, but centered in
              74 characters, to be used in the file header comment.

  %(YEAR)d    will be replaced by the current year.
  %(DATE)s    will be replaced by the current date.
  %(TIME)s    will be replaced by the current time.

  %(HEADER_GUARD)s  will be replaced by the UPPER_CASE_PATH_H_ to the file.

  %(CMAKE_PROJECT_NAME)s  will be replaced by lower_case_path to the target
                          directory.

  %(CMAKE_PROJECT_PATH)s  will be replaced by the path to the target directory.

Copyright: (c) 2010, Knut Reinert, FU Berlin
License:   3-clause BSD (see LICENSE)
"""

def createDirectory(path, dry_run=False):
    print('mkdir(%s)' % path)
    print()
    if not dry_run:
        if not os.path.exists(path):
            os.mkdir(path)

def configureFile(target_file, source_file, replacements, dry_run, options):
    print('Configuring file.')
    print('  Source:', source_file)
    print('  Target:', target_file)
    print()
    if os.path.exists(target_file) and not options.force:
        msg = 'Target file already exists.  Move it away and call the script again.'
        print(msg, file=sys.stderr)
        return 1

    with open(source_file, 'rb') as f:
        contents = f.read()
    target_contents = contents % replacements
    if dry_run:
        print('The contents of the target file are:')
        print('-' * 78)
        print(target_contents)
        print('-' * 78)
    else:
        with open(target_file, 'wb') as f:
            f.write(target_contents)
    return 0

def _pathToIdentifier(relative_path):
    result = relative_path.replace('/', '_')
    result = result.replace('\\', '_')
    result = result.replace('-', '_')
    result = result.replace('.', '_')
    result = result.replace(' ', '_')
    return result

def buildReplacements(type_, name, location, target_file, options):
    result = {}
    result['AUTHOR'] = options.author
    result['YEAR'] = datetime.date.today().year
    result['TIME'] = datetime.datetime.now().strftime('%H:%M')
    result['DATE'] = datetime.date.today().strftime('%Y-%m-%d')
    result['NAME'] = name
    result['TITLE'] = name.center(HEADER_CENTER_WIDTH).rstrip()
    path = os.path.relpath(target_file, paths.repositoryRoot())
    guard = _pathToIdentifier(path).upper()
    result['HEADER_GUARD'] = guard + '_'
    path = os.path.relpath(os.path.dirname(target_file),
                           paths.repositoryRoot())
    cmake_project_name = _pathToIdentifier(path)
    result['CMAKE_PROJECT_NAME'] = cmake_project_name
    result['CMAKE_PROJECT_PATH'] = path.replace('\\', '\\\\')
    if type_ == 'repository':
        result['REPOSITORY_PSEUDO_TARGET_NAME'] = name.replace('/', '_').replace('\\', '_').replace(' ', '_')
    if type_ == 'app_tests':
        result['APP_NAME'] = os.path.split(os.path.split(location)[0])[1]
        result['APP_NAME_U'] = result['APP_NAME'].upper()
        result['LOCATION'] = os.path.join(os.path.split(os.path.normpath(location))[0])
    return result
